The analytical edge: even in a booming market, brokers are under increasing pressure to perform

Article Abstract:

The pressures facing the Australian broking industry are discussed. Fund managers are undertaking their own research, thus scaling down the number of brokers they use, and brokers are now expected to give improved service in areas such as fulfilling orders.

Pretty Girl claims it was sold a pup, not a profit

Article Abstract:

Issues concerning the dispute between Woolworths and Pretty girl over the sale of Rockmans Stores are discussed. Woolworths sold the 258 store fashion chain Rockmans for A$50 million in December 1999 to Pretty Girl.

County, from high flier to yesterday's hero

Article Abstract:

Issues are presented concerning the performance of County Investment Management before and after it was acquired by the National Australia Bank. The changing role of chairman Charles Macek is discussed.
